After 14 nights and 15 days of captivity in Concord hospital I have escaped. Born again baby inside a 57 body.  I am out of danger, curled up on the sofa at home, with comfort blankie, Paddy and laptop. Thank you for all the messages of support, love, advice. I am not very brave or strong; I am mostly stoic but have cried like a baby several times in the last 2 weeks. It has been horrific. A process to endure. Something I wish never to repeat. The first three days went to plan The Central line insertion. (Day -2) I was sedated. I felt the knife go in but it was like a few taps on my skin (oh boy did it sting like hell later) The surgeon told me he had used 18cm of tube (right side under collar bone to heart)  The high dose melphalan (Day -1) infused along with litres of sodium chloride (saline) Deadly and toxic but did not feel a thing.
